Output ffd30826df5c652cb5dcfa56a68b3d4fdf48b0a7f757107cfcb2e8b51f924434:0

value
42980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d34939352e1c38f6246ef292b62048556744578 OP_EQUALVERIFY OP_CHECKSIG
address
1DsdG8FdtrEA9wuQ2N7tCDQSGcaRaGtNTo
transaction
ffd30826df5c652cb5dcfa56a68b3d4fdf48b0a7f757107cfcb2e8b51f924434
spent
true